html{background-color:#f2f2f2;font-size:100%;height:100%}body{font-size:100%}img{height:auto;max-width:100%}#ie-clr{height:0;line-height:0}.responsive h1,.responsive h2,.responsive h3,.responsive h4,.responsive h5,.responsive h6{margin-bottom:1.5%}#wrapper{background:#f2f2f2;margin:0;min-width:320px;overflow:hidden;width:100%}#width,main.responsive-content{margin:0 auto;min-width:320px;max-width:1024px;overflow:hidden}.responsive #header,.responsive header{background:none;height:auto;margin:0 !important;padding:0;position:static;width:100%}.responsive #header-wrapper{margin:0 auto !important;max-width:1024px;min-width:320px;padding:1% 0 1%;width:98%}.responsive #header-wrapper .main-logo-claim{color:#006567;float:left;font-family:"Xing Sans", Georgia, serif;font-size:18px;padding-left:15px;padding-top:40px}.responsive .home{background:url(https://www.xing.com/assets/welcome/xing_welcome_sprite-e91023b58bc919b4aa93f483e345307b625614ec3d6a9be66d7b19295ce8ce71.png) no-repeat;background-position:0px 14px}.responsive .home a{background:none}.responsive #header .xing-logo,.responsive header .xing-logo{background:url("/assets/frontend_minified/img/svg/logo-pos.svg") no-repeat;background-position:left bottom;display:block;float:left;font-size:0;height:45px;margin-left:30px;width:75px}.responsive #header .login,.responsive header .login{display:block}.responsive #footer,.responsive footer{background:none;margin-top:0;padding:0;text-align:center}.responsive footer #quicklinks,.responsive footer .footer-legal,.responsive footer .footer-copyright{background:none}.responsive #footer .confine,.responsive footer .content-center{width:100%;max-width:1024px}.responsive #footer dl,.responsive footer .footer-links{width:100%}.responsive #footer .border{background:none;color:#474747;padding-top:0}.responsive #footer a,.responsive #footer a:hover,.responsive footer a,.responsive footer a:hover{color:gray;margin-left:8px}.responsive #footer a.dropdown-link,.responsive footer .dropdown-link{color:#474747}.responsive .footer-links.last{line-height:20px}.responsive .footer-legal,.responsive .footer-copyright{font-size:16px}.responsive #quicklinks .first{margin-left:0}#to-top,.only-mobile{display:none}button.button-as-link:focus,button.button-as-link:active{background-color:transparent;box-shadow:none}.responsive .mini-signup-container{background-color:transparent;position:absolute;right:55px;top:145px;width:230px;z-index:1}@media (-webkit-min-device-pixel-ratio: 2), (min-resolution: 192dpi){.logged-out-startpage .equation p.icon,.phone-panel a>span{background-image:url(/img/sections/startpage/tv_spot/sprite_mobile_retina.png);background-size:250px 600px}}.responsive .lot{margin:0 0.5%}.responsive .column{float:left}.responsive .half.column{margin:0 0.5%;padding:0.5% 1%;width:47%}.responsive .one-third.column{margin:0 0.5%;padding:0.5% 1%;width:30.33%}.responsive .two-third.column{margin:0 0.5%;padding:0.5% 1%;width:63.66%}.responsive .one-quarter{margin:0 0.5%;padding:0.5% 1%;width:22%}.responsive .three-quarter.column{margin:0 0.5%;padding:0.5% 1%;width:72%}.responsive #header .login,.responsive header .login{float:right}.responsive #header .login .login-btn,.responsive header .login-btn{margin:30px 55px 0 0;padding:10px}.responsive .mini-signup-container .mini-signup-2{display:block}@media only screen and (min-width: 768px) and (max-width: 959px){.responsive h1{font-size:2em}.responsive h2{font-size:1.375em;line-height:1em}.responsive h3{font-size:1.250em}.responsive h4,.responsive h5{font-size:1em}.responsive #header-wrapper{width:99%}.responsive .lot,.responsive #header-wrapper .half.column{padding:1% 2%;width:95%}.responsive .half.column.nofloat,.responsive .one-third.column.nofloat,.responsive .two-third.column.nofloat,.responsive .one-quarter.column.nofloat,.responsive .three-quarter.column.nofloat{padding:1% 2%;width:80%}.responsive .half.column,.responsive .one-third.column,.responsive .two-third.column,.responsive .one-quarter.column,.responsive .three-quarter.column{padding:1% 2%;margin:0 0.5%}.responsive .half.column,.responsive .one-quarter.column,.responsive .three-quarter.column{width:45%}.responsive .one-third.column{width:28.33%}.responsive .two-third.column{width:61.66%}}@media only screen and (max-width: 767px){body{line-height:131.3%}.responsive h1{font-size:2em;line-height:1.3em}.responsive h2{font-size:1.375em}.responsive h3{font-size:1.250em}.responsive h4,.responsive h5{font-size:1em}.responsive label{position:relative}.responsive input.text{font-size:1em;padding:4% 1%}.responsive .column{float:none}.responsive .lot,.responsive .half.column,.responsive .one-third.column,.responsive .two-third.column,.responsive .one-quarter.column,.responsive .three-quarter.column{padding:1% 2%;margin:0 1%;width:94%}.responsive .only-mobile{display:block}.responsive #login-layer{margin-top:0}.responsive #login-layer .content-flip{height:290px}.responsive #login-layer .front,.responsive #login-layer .back{padding:2% 3%;width:94%}.responsive #footer,.responsive footer{line-height:2em}.responsive footer{padding-top:50px}.responsive .mini-signup .terms-and-conditions{width:232px}}@media only screen and (min-width: 480px) and (max-width: 767px){.responsive #top-nav>li>a{padding:6% 0}.responsive input.text{padding:2% 0.5%}.responsive .breadcrumb-nav li,.responsive .breadcrumb-nav li.homebase{padding:3% 3% 2%}.responsive .img-list li{font-size:1em}}@media only screen and (max-width: 479px){.responsive #width,.responsive main.responsive-content{min-width:100%}.responsive #header-wrapper{margin:0 2%;min-width:96%}.responsive .mini-signup form{padding:0 15px}.responsive .mini-signup-container{bottom:auto;margin-right:0;right:auto;top:15px;width:100%}.responsive .mini-signup-container .mini-signup-2{margin:0 auto;width:220px}}.column.pdgbtm0{padding-bottom:0}.mrgnbtm0{margin-bottom:0}.mrgntop5,.mrgntop5.column{margin-top:5px}.mrgntop10,.mrgntop10.column{margin-top:10px}.mrgntop15,.mrgntop15.column{margin-top:15px}.mrgntop20,.mrgntop20.column{margin-top:20px}.mrgntop25,.mrgntop25.column{margin-top:25px}.mrgntop30,.mrgntop30.column{margin-top:30px}.mrgntop35,.mrgntop35.column{margin-top:35px}.mrgntop40,.mrgntop40.column{margin-top:40px}.top-bordered{border-top:1px solid #bbb}.bottom-bordered{border-bottom:1px solid #bbb}.box,.column.box{background:#ebebeb}.center{text-align:center}.middle,.middle.column{margin-left:auto;margin-right:auto}.nofloat{float:none !important}.img-fl{float:left;margin-right:2%}.img-fr{float:right;margin-left:2%}.bgimg{background-size:100% auto;background-position:center center}.video{position:relative;padding-bottom:56%;padding-top:30px;height:0;overflow:hidden}.video iframe,.video object,.video embed{position:absolute;top:0;left:0;width:100%;height:100%}
